site stats

Convert minix3 to riscv

WebThe value of __riscv_v_elen is defined by the following rules: 64, if the V extension or one of the Zve64 {x,f,d} extensions is present; and. 32, if one of the Zve32 {x,f} extensions is present. If multiple rules apply, the maximum value is taken. If none of the rules apply, __riscv_v_elen is undefined. Webriscv.org

C-to-RiscV_CrossCompilationInstructions.md · GitHub - Gist

WebIf you want to run MINIX 3 on a simulator instead of native, see Part V first. Download the MINIX 3 CD-ROM image Download the MINIX 3 CD-ROM image from the DOWNLOAD … WebJan 11, 2024 · Recently, Minix's file layout has been re-organized, and many utilities have been brought over from NetBSD including its package manager. So, Minix is no longer … garage door repair clermont fl https://studiumconferences.com

Minix3

WebFeb 25, 2024 · This is a web-based graphical simulator for a simple 32-bit, single-cycle implementation of RISC-V. education riscv risc-v riscv32 risc-v-assembly risc-v-architecture risc-v-simulator Updated on Sep 11, 2024 TypeScript Kyuvi / lrv-asm Star 2 Code Issues Pull requests RISC-V assembler in Common Lisp WebMIPS Assembly Interpreter written in Javascript. Features. Reset to load the code, Step one instruction, or Run all instructions; Set a breakpoint by clicking on the line number (only for Run); View registers on the right, memory on the bottom of this page; Supported Instructions WebInstalling MINIX 3 on a PC Installation is simple. First you download the CD-ROM image, which is a .iso file, by clicking on the “Download Now” button on the main page. Save the file. Then if you are going to install on a PC, first butn the .iso file to a CD-ROM and boot the computer from it. garage door repair christian county

Installing MINIX 3

Category:ucb-bar/riscv-mini: Simple RISC-V 3-stage Pipeline in …

Tags:Convert minix3 to riscv

Convert minix3 to riscv

riscv - I need to convert C (or better) into RISC-V that …

WebFeb 21, 2024 · Riscv assembly implementation of an image processing program, using convolution of 3x3 kernels. image-processing riscv64 riscv-assembly Updated on May 18, 2024 Assembly imlyzh / riscv-process-rs Star 0 Code Issues Pull requests This is a RISC-V process library parser python-library riscv rust-library rust-crate rust-application riscv … WebAnswer (1 of 2): It depends on what exactly you want to learn. If you want to learn general Unix organization, like where each configuration file is located, what are their effect, the …

Convert minix3 to riscv

Did you know?

WebSoftware for converting binary or hex instructions to their assembly code Can some please recommend me a solution for converting RISC-V binary or hex instructions into assembly instructions. I tried Ripes but it did not worked for me 12 9 9 comments Add a Comment konze • 3 yr. ago Doesn‘t objdump do that for you? 8 haseebazaz • 3 yr. ago WebWhat Is MINIX 3? MINIX 3 is a free, open-source, operating system designed to be highly reliable, flexible, and secure. It is based on a tiny microkernel running in kernel mode with the rest of the operating system running as a number of isolated, protected, processes in user mode. It runs on x86 and ARM CPUs, is compatible with NetBSD, and ...

WebSep 9, 2024 · My idea is to modify the lexer and parser yacc provided by the open-source project QTSPIM. The lexer analyzes the input MIPS assembly and it creates the tokens … http://www.columbia.edu/~njn2118/journal/2024/1/11.html

WebFirst, you should have riscv-gnu-toolchain to make the compilation and decompilation process. It can be found here . The instructions that you mentioned are assembly. So, you can compile by riscv64-unknown-elf-as and disassemble by riscv64-unknown-elf-objdump. The instructions used to get hex are below. WebApr 3, 2024 · Apr 3, 2024. I’ve made a RISC-V emulator that can run xv6, a simple Unix-like OS for education. All the source code of the emulator is available in the d0iasm/rvemu repository. In this article, I’m going to introduce emulator’s features implemented for running the OS, by looking back at the source code that made major changes.

WebThe RISC-V Instruction Set Manual Volume I: Unprivileged ISA Document Version 20240608-Base-Ratified Editors: Andrew Waterman 1, Krste Asanovi´c,2 1SiFive Inc., …

WebInstalling MINIX 3 on a PC. Installation is simple. First you download the CD-ROM image, which is a .iso file, by clicking on the “Download Now” button on the main page. Save the … garage door repair cincinnati+waysWebMIPS Assembly Interpreter written in Javascript. Features. Reset to load the code, Step one instruction, or Run all instructions; Set a breakpoint by clicking on the line number (only … black man with jerry curlWebSep 11, 2010 · % riscv-objdump --disassemble-all --disassemble-zeroes \--section=.text --section=.data riscv-v1_simple > riscv-v1_simple.dump Compare the original riscv-v1 simple.S le to the generated riscv-v1 simple.dump le. Using a combination of the assembly le and the objdump le you can get a good feel for what the test garage door repair clearwaterWebRISC-V userspace emulator library. libriscv is a simple and slim RISC-V userspace emulator library that is highly embeddable and configurable. There are several CMake options that control RISC-V extensions and how the emulator behaves.. There is also a CLI that you can use to run RISC-V programs and step through instructions one by one, like … garage door repair cleveland heightsWebMay 4, 2024 · The Minix 3 file system has two bitmaps, one for the zones (blocks) as demonstrated above, and one for inodes (explained below). One interesting portion of the super block is called the magic. This is a … black man with jaundiceWebFreedomStudio. After download and extract the FreedomStudio for windows. You have to set the system PATH to the folder of riscv64-unknown-elf-gcc/bin and riscv-qemu/bin. … Issues - cccriscv/mini-riscv-os - Github Pull requests 1 - cccriscv/mini-riscv-os - Github Actions - cccriscv/mini-riscv-os - Github GitHub is where people build software. More than 94 million people use GitHub … GitHub is where people build software. More than 83 million people use GitHub … 01-HelloOs - cccriscv/mini-riscv-os - Github 03-MultiTasking - cccriscv/mini-riscv-os - Github 07-ExterInterrupt - cccriscv/mini-riscv-os - Github 02-ContextSwitch - cccriscv/mini-riscv-os - Github 06-Spinlock - cccriscv/mini-riscv-os - Github black man with helmetWebApr 25, 2024 · Viewed 554 times 0 Im trying to convert this C code to riscv (64 bit) : int a=10,b=10,i=0,j=0; int D [200]; for (i=0;i<=a;i++) for (j=0;j black man with infant